It’s All My Fault!
2006.10.31 @ 18:59:53 -0600 under Life, Sports
After a very blistering start to the regular season, to winning the division with about 15 games left, to loosing the division to the Twins on the last day of regular season, to beating Yankees and Athletics in the first two rounds of MLB PlayOffs, Detroit Tigers had a hell of a season and gave us plenty to cheer/talk/brag about. However World Series (it’s just a National Championship and there is just one team from Canada, I suppose) turned out to be a complete disaster - too many fielding errors and lack of offense to make up for defensive errors meant that St. Louis Cardinals finally managed to return the 1968 favor…
I wouldn’t completely blame Tigers’ poor show alone for loosing the MLB Championship - yours-truly is to be blamed equally, if not less. What did I do, you ask? I supported the Tigers! Being in Michigan, isn’t that your duty, you ask? Well, allow me to explain -


- 2003-04 NBA Season : Detroit Pistons won The Finals beating LA Lakers and guess who I was supporting? yeah - LA Lakers
- 2004-05 NBA Season : Detroit Pistons lost The Finals to San Antonio Spurs and guess who I was supporting? Pistons
- 2005-06 NBA Season : Detroit Pistons lost Eastern Conference Finals to Miami Heat and who I was supporting? Pistons
- 2003-04 MLB Season : Detroit Tigers didn’t qualify for PlayOffs
- 2004-05 MLB Season : Detroit Tigers didn’t qualify for PlayOffs
- 2005-06 MLB Season : Detroit Tigers lost the World Series to St. Louis Cardinals
Need more evidence? With 2006-07 NBA Season starting this week, you know who I will be supporting - especially when it comes to the PlayOffs…
